Positioned For Long-Term Growth
Videogame industry growth projections continue to be very
bright, given the strong velocity of new hardware sales,
which should drive software sales well into the future.
With a solid slate of drive titles, including Saints Row 2,
Red Faction: Guerrilla, de Blob, WALL-E and WWE® Smack-
Down® vs. Raw® 2009, along with improvements to our
product development organization and processes, and a
re-alignment of our cost structure, we are confident in our
ability to increase revenue and profitability in fiscal 2009.
We are determined to execute at a high level and deliver
on our strategy in order to generate strong results going
forward.

Expanding Digital Opportunities
We will also continue to execute on our strategy of devel-
oping new revenue streams through digital distribution.
We are working with leading game operator Shanda
Interactive Entertainment Limited to release a fully
online version of our critically acclaimed Company of
Heroes® in the Chinese market in fiscal 2009. We intend
to grow our leadership in wireless gaming with new
games based on Star Wars, the new Indiana Jones film,
the Playboy brand as well as extensions of our popular
console brands.
In fiscal 2008, we strengthened our wireless develop-
ment capability with the acquisition of leading mobile
games developer Universomo, Ltd.
